This paper investigates how to use robust model prediction control in air-conditioning systems. Air-conditioning processes are described using a first-order plus time-delay model associated with uncertainties in process gain, time constant and time-delay. The design of a robust two-degree-of-freedom (2-DOF) controller for a flight motion simulator is presented. Considering the load variation, torque disturbance, high-frequency mechanical resonance, input saturation and tracking precision, the controller is designed including a feedback controller and a feedforward controller to satisfy robust stability and robust performance simultaneously. This paper investigates the application of different H∞ design methods to multivariable flight control system design for a VSTOL aircraft. Designs are based on linearised models at an airspeed of 120 knots.
